Debenhams

The brand Debenhams was among the most famous names on the Great British high street. It was established in 1818 and its first store was outside of London. The company expanded rapidly and even bought Knightsbridge retailer Harvey Nichols in 1928.

In the late nineties, with Belinda Earl as chief executive the company grew again. She introduced the popular Designers at Debenhams brand, where top fashion designers provided items priced at Debenhams prices. She also took the first step towards international growth by opening stores in Bahrain, Kuwait and other countries.

The company was in financial trouble. By 2022, the last Debenhams stores had shut down, and the company was sold to the online rival Boohoo. The sale left vacant retail spaces in town centres, which are difficult to reuse. Fortunately, some of these spaces have been converted to residential and co-working spaces.
